Your toilet may keep bubbling after flushing due to a clog in the drain pipe, a malfunctioning vent pipe, or a problem with the toilet's flushing mechanism. It is important to address this issue promptly to prevent further damage to your Plumbing system.

What make a ktchen sink make a bubbling noise everytime you flush the bathroom toilet?

Sink is not vented properly and the water from the p-trap under the sink COULD be sucked out by the hydrostatic pressure from the toilet flushing.


Why is my toilet bubbling and not flushing properly?

Your toilet may be bubbling and not flushing properly due to a clog in the drain pipe, a malfunctioning flapper or fill valve, or a problem with the vent stack. It is recommended to check for any obstructions in the drain pipe, inspect the flapper and fill valve for any damage, and ensure the vent stack is clear of debris. If the issue persists, it may be necessary to seek professional plumbing assistance.
